Why We Always Ask About Slab Thickness First

Every time someone searches for a 4-post lift near me and calls us, our first questions aren’t about color or brand — they’re about the floor. Standard residential garage slabs run about 4 inches thick, and that’s fine for parking cars but marginal for concentrated lift loads, especially on older pours without much rebar. We had a call recently from a homeowner near Ankeny with a standard 4-inch slab wanting an 8,000-9,000 lb 4-post lift for a home garage, and that’s exactly the scenario where we slow down and look at the actual pour before quoting anything.

Most manufacturers, including Rotary and BendPak, specify a minimum of 4 inches of properly cured, unreinforced or reinforced concrete at a minimum PSI rating, but thickness alone doesn’t tell the whole story. Cure time matters — a slab poured last month hasn’t reached full strength yet. Cracks, expansion joints, and proximity to the edge of the slab all change where a lift can safely sit. We’ve turned down installs on slabs that looked fine to the homeowner but had hairline cracking running right through a planned column location. It’s not us being difficult; it’s the difference between a lift that sits solid for twenty years and one that starts rocking after eighteen months.

Rebar: When It Matters and When It Doesn’t

Rebar comes up constantly in our conversations with customers, and there’s a lot of confusion about whether it’s required. For most 4-post lifts, which distribute weight across four wide footprints rather than two narrow columns, rebar isn’t strictly mandatory the way it often is for 2-post lifts anchored into a smaller footprint. That said, if you’re pouring new concrete specifically for a lift installation, we always recommend rebar or fiber mesh reinforcement anyway — it’s cheap insurance against future cracking, especially in Iowa where freeze-thaw cycles stress slabs that meet an unheated garage wall.

We worked through a quote for a shop out near Maxwell with 6-inch concrete, in-floor heat, and rebar already in the pour, wanting a 4-post lift rated for 9,000 lb to store a Camaro or Jeep. That’s about as solid a foundation as we see — 6 inches with reinforcement gives real margin. Compare that to a bare 4-inch slab with no rebar and you can see why we quote those two jobs very differently, even though the lift itself might be identical. If your slab has rebar, tell us where it runs and how deep, because it changes how we plan anchor points.

Anchoring: The Part Nobody Thinks About Until Install Day

A 4-post lift near me search usually ends with someone assuming installation is just “bolt it to the floor,” but anchoring is where slab quality actually gets tested. Wedge anchors need a minimum embedment depth into solid, uncracked concrete to hold rated load. If your slab is thin, or if there’s a control joint running through a footprint location, we have to reposition the whole lift layout or recommend a concrete contractor pour a reinforced pad first.

This is also where mobile 4-post lifts change the calculation. Several customers have asked us about mobile capability specifically because they’re not 100% sure where the lift will live long-term, or because they’re renting. Mobile columns still need a reasonably solid, level floor to roll and set on, but they don’t require the same anchor bolt commitment since they’re not permanently fixed. If your slab is borderline and you don’t want to repour concrete right now, a mobile setup can be the practical middle ground until you’re ready for a permanent installation.

Ceiling Height and Bay Width Change the Math Too

Slab strength gets the most attention, but we can’t quote a 4-post lift near me request without knowing ceiling height and bay width either. We’ve had customers with 11-foot ceilings in a 3.5-car garage, and others with 16-foot ceilings and 30-foot-wide bays wanting the same weight rating. The taller and wider your space, the more lift models are actually usable — some 4-post configurations need more overhead clearance than people expect once you add the vehicle height on top of the lift’s own rise.

We map slab condition, ceiling height, and bay width together because changing one changes what’s possible with the others. A shorter ceiling might push us toward a lower-profile lift; a narrower bay might mean choosing a model with a tighter footprint even if the slab could technically handle a wider unit. What a Real Site Visit Actually Checks

When we do an in-person or photo-based site check before installing, we’re looking at slab thickness through any available core sample or edge view, checking for visible cracking or spalling, measuring flatness with a level across the footprint area, and confirming there’s no radiant heat tubing sitting exactly where an anchor needs to go — because in-floor heat lines are common in newer Iowa shops and hitting one with a drill is a very bad day.

We also ask about how the space gets used, not just its dimensions. A garage used for weekend maintenance work is a different anchoring conversation than a shop where a lift holds a stored vehicle month after month with another one parked underneath. Static storage load and cyclic lifting load stress a slab differently over time, and knowing which one you’re planning for helps us recommend the right footprint and, when needed, the right reinforcement before the bolts ever go in.

Getting the Right Lift Once the Floor Checks Out

Once we know your slab can handle it, choosing among 4-post options gets a lot simpler. Weight ratings in the range people usually ask about — 7,000 to 14,000 lb — cover the vast majority of home garage and small shop use cases, whether you’re storing a daily driver and a project car or doing general maintenance on a passenger vehicle. If storage is your main goal rather than working underneath the vehicle, we’ll usually point you toward a straightforward storage-rated 4-post configuration. If you want to actually do maintenance — oil changes, brake work, tire rotations — while a second vehicle sits stored on top, that changes the model recommendation and sometimes the ramp or rolling jack accessories you’ll want alongside it. Either way, get the slab question answered first; everything else about picking the right 4-post lift near me gets easier once that’s settled.
